Balanced Trees: AVL and Red-Black Trees - Implementations in C++ - Problem Set

Download Q&A
Q. How many rotations are needed in the worst case for a single insertion in an AVL tree?
  • A. 1
  • B. 2
  • C. 3
  • D. 4
Q. What is the primary operation performed to maintain balance in an AVL tree after insertion?
  • A. Rotation
  • B. Recoloring
  • C. Splitting
  • D. Merging
Q. What is the worst-case time complexity for searching in a Red-Black tree?
  • A. O(n)
  • B. O(log n)
  • C. O(n log n)
  • D. O(1)
Q. Which of the following operations is NOT typically performed on a tree data structure?
  • A. Insertion
  • B. Deletion
  • C. Traversal
  • D. Sorting
Q. Which traversal method is used to retrieve nodes in sorted order from a binary search tree?
  • A. Pre-order
  • B. Post-order
  • C. In-order
  • D. Level-order
Showing 1 to 5 of 5 (1 Pages)
Soulshift Feedback ×

On a scale of 0–10, how likely are you to recommend The Soulshift Academy?

Not likely Very likely